Finding the Best Electricity Deals for Small Businesses
Small enterprises are constantly looking for ways to get more info reduce costs and maximize profits. One area where significant cost reductions can be achieved is in electricity expenditure. By carefully comparing electric prices from various providers, small companies can obtain more budget-friendly energy solutions.
A crucial first step is to grasp your current energy usage. Track your bi-monthly bills and pinpoint peak hours of use. This information will help you in determining an electricity plan that most effectively meets your needs.
Once you have a distinct understanding of your energy consumption, you can begin to evaluate prices from different providers. Employ online tools and consult energy brokers to obtain quotes from different providers. Scrutinize factors such as contract, renegotiations, and any pertinent fees.
By performing a thorough comparison of electric prices, small companies can find more budget-friendly energy solutions. This, in turn, can free up valuable resources to be allocated towards expansion and further critical aspects of the enterprise.
Tackling the Complexities of Business Gas Pricing
Businesses across numerous fields are confronting a dynamic and often perplexing gas pricing landscape. Volatile energy costs can significantly influence profitability, making it essential for companies to prudently manage their fuel expenses.
Several factors contribute to the complexity of gas pricing, comprising global supply and demand dynamics, geopolitical events, and seasonal fluctuations. Moreover, businesses often face unclear pricing structures from energy providers, making it challenging to forecast future costs.
To navigate in this volatile environment, businesses must implement a multifaceted approach that includes strategies for reduction, procurement, and risk management.
Regularly monitoring market trends, assessing pricing options, and building strong relationships with energy providers are essential to success.
By embracing a proactive and analytical approach to gas pricing, businesses can mitigate their financial exposure and ensure long-term viability.
